Transaction 6523f8de573c40befbd97d8a7c46b50f7fa6ce5d61720b127f01540590331a5d

2 Input
2 Outputs
  • 6523f8de573c40befbd97d8a7c46b50f7fa6ce5d61720b127f01540590331a5d:0
  • value  17700880
    address  3Hw2u9rm8nDb7Jad64veez8waboHYzF9nk
  • 6523f8de573c40befbd97d8a7c46b50f7fa6ce5d61720b127f01540590331a5d:1
  • value  71970494
    address  3LTZHjmU6LEzfB8PEJf9NwUvLU4djdi9ki